Reporte de modo grafico awt swing
PAQUETE JAVA.AWT
El paquete java.awt proporciona una serie de clases e interfaces para realizar programas que se ejecuten en un entorno gráfico (AWT viene del inglés Abstract Window Toolkit).
Jerarquía de componentes del AWT
java.awt.Graphics: Proporciona métodos para dibujar figuras, fonts, imágenes, etc. Representa el contexto gráfico deun componente o imagen.
Component: Superclase abstracta de varios componentes del AWT. Tiene un método public Graphics getGraphics() para obtener el contexto gráfico sobre el que dibujar figuras o componentes. Declara más de 200 métodos.
void paint(Graphics)/ void repaint()/void update(Graphics) : Dibujo y actualización del componente en pantalla.
boolean isVisible()/voidsetVisible(boolean): Comprueba o establece si el componente es visible.
boolean isOpaque(): Determina si el componente es completamente opaco o no.
Point getLocation()/Point getLocationOnScreen()/void setLocation(Point)/void setLocation(int, int): Obtiene o establece la posición del componente respecto al componente padre o respecto a la pantalla.
Dimension getSize()/void setSize(int, int)/voidsetSize(Dimension)/int getWidth()/int getHeight(): Obtiene o establece el tamaño de un componente, en pixels o como un objeto Dimension.
boolean isEnabled()/void setEnabled(boolean): Permite saber si un componente está activado y activarlo o desactivarlo.
Rectangle getBounds()/void setBounds(Rectangle)/void set Bounds(int, int, int): Obtiene o establece el tamaño y posición de un componente en funcióndel rectángulo que lo comprende.
float getAlignmentX()/float getAlignmentY(): Obtiene la alineación del componente. Las constantes correspondientes son: C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T:ALIGNMENT, TOP_ALIGNMENT y BOTTOM_ALIGNMENT.
Color getForeground()/Color getBackground()/void setForeground(Color)/ void setBackground(Color): Obtiene o establece el color de fondo o de primer plano delcomponente.
Font getFont()/void setFont(Font): Obtiene o establece la fuente para ese componente.
Container getParent(): Obtiene el padre del componente
String getName()/void setName(String): Obtiene o establece el nombre del componente según la cadena proporcionada.
setLocale(Locale)/Locale getLocale(): Obtiene o establece la localidad del componente. La localidad tiene en cuentaaspectos culturales regionales o políticos para adaptar el componente.
ComponentOrientation/getComponentOrientation()/
void setComponentOrientation(ComponentOrientation): Obtiene o establece la orientación en la que se ordenarán los elementos contenidos en función del idioma (o cultura). Por defecto es de izquierda a derecha. La orientación depende también de la localidad asignada al componente.public void mousePressed( MouseEvent evento ): Se llama cuando se oprime un botón del ratón, mientras el cursor del ratón está sobre un componente.
public void mouseClicked( MouseEvent evento ): Se llama cuando se oprime y suelta un botón del ratón, mientras el cursor del ratón permanece estacionario sobre un componente. Este evento siempre va precedido por una llamada a mousePressed.public void mouseReleased( MouseEvent evento ): Se llama cuando se suelta un botón de ratón después de ser oprimido. Este evento siempre va precedido por una llamada a mousePressedy por una o más llamadas a mouseDragged.
public void mouseEntered( MouseEvent evento ): Se llama cuando el cursor del ratón entra a los límites de un componente.
public void mouseExited( MouseEvent evento ): Se llamacuando el cursor del ratón sale de los límites de un componente.
public void mouseDragged( MouseEvent evento ): Se llama cuando el botón del ratón se oprime mientras el cursor del ratón se encuentra sobre un componente y se mueve mientras el botón sigue oprimido. Este evento siempre va precedido por una llamada a mousePressed. Todos los eventos de arrastre del ratón se envían al componente en...
Regístrate para leer el documento completo.